Topcoder是一個知名的在線編程大賽平臺,由Jack Hughes在2001年4月創立,后被Appirio和Wipro相繼收購。Topcoder起初為大學學生舉辦SRM(每場時長1.5小時的算法學術活動),后來在逐漸的發展下,平臺在Topcoder挑戰的基礎上開始舉辦TCO(Topcoder公開賽)。
TCO由Topcoder中最有威望的成員設計,TCO包含多項比賽:算法,設計,程序開發,F2F(最速完成),馬拉松和每一場比賽所對應的答辯環節。
在每一次Topcoder挑戰結束之后,所有參賽者可以自由訪問優勝者的代碼并以此來進行比對,對自己的編程能力進行提升。
Topcoder Open(TCO) 2020的線上賽從2019年10月1日開始到2020年7月31日結束。
TCO2020的線上賽分為以下三個階段:
階段一?? ?????? 2019年10月1日到2019年12月31日
階段二????????? 2020年1月1日到2020年3月31日
階段三????????? 2020年4月1日到2020年6月30日
在每個階段中,參賽者除了參加標準的Topcoder挑戰來獲得獎金和TCO分數之外,還可以通過贏得特殊的含有TCO標識的比賽項目來賺取更多額外的TCO分數。在每一階段比賽結束之后,擁有足夠高TCO點數的人將會獲得獎金并可以去美國參加TCO年度總決賽。
數據科學
馬拉松:時長一周的算法學術活動,在比賽過程中有多種題目需要參賽者進行完成。允許使用的計算機語言有C++,java,C#,VB。在一周結束之后,在計分板位于榜首的人即為勝者。
F2F:在賽題公布之后,首個成功編寫完成的人獲勝
Sprint:該項比賽包含一系列賽題,由人工進行手動測試,在比賽過程中沒有實時計分板
數據可視化:由評委主觀進行評價,程序的要求需要輸入一系列數據,輸出這些數據的可視化成果
程序開發
問題調試:在現有的軟件產品中修改存在的數個小問題
編程:該學術活動的第一階段為時長五天的比賽階段,第二階段為時長四天的用戶反饋,程序調試階段。比賽主題由贊助方而定
F2F:這項比賽的時長沒有限定。首個提交正確解決方案的人獲得唯一的獎項
質量保證:對于提供的軟件產品進行測試和維修錯誤
UI設計:對于軟件程序外觀的設計比賽,評委會根據參賽者的設計理念,設計元素和用戶可用性進行打分
Topcoder的會員注冊沒有門檻,在填寫相關個人信息之后即可成為會員。

? 2025. All Rights Reserved. 滬ICP備2023009024號-1